Block 1998591

e7776418aa49e0d121c1231836efa7fa99e4e27ed331f8fedf86eb2c2e891777
Transactions1
Height1998591
Confirmations3367441
TimestampSun, 10 Dec 2017 01:02:19 UTC
Size (bytes)197
Version2
Merkle Root6d18fdeef2b94ea8041724c4f904c4a589d155a1f9593e5d376aa9fdf2d91a0f
Nonce4038879659
Bits1c071164
Difficulty36.21937634390031

Transactions

No Inputs (Newly Generated Coins)
Fee: 0 FTC
3367441 Confirmations40 FTC